In a tightly contested match, the Calgary Flames edged the Edmonton Oilers 3-2 at home. The game was a thrilling back-and-forth affair, with the Flames showcasing their ability to capitalize on key moments, while the Oilers fought valiantly but fell just short.
The Flames started the game strong, taking the lead early in the first period. Yegor Sharangovich opened the scoring, giving Calgary a boost of momentum. The Oilers quickly responded, with Evan Bouchard tying the game shortly after. Throughout the match, both teams exchanged chances, but it was the Flames who managed to find the back of the net more frequently.
The victory allowed the Flames to secure two crucial points in the standings, keeping them competitive as the season progresses. The Oilers, while showing flashes of brilliance, will need to regroup after this narrow defeat.
The defining moment of the game came in the third period when Blake Coleman scored at 12:31, extending the Flames’ lead to 3-1. This goal shifted the momentum firmly in favor of Calgary and added pressure on the Oilers to respond. Although Connor McDavid managed to score minutes later, it wasn’t enough to complete the comeback.
The Flames' ability to convert on their opportunities, especially during that pivotal moment, proved to be the difference-maker in the match.
For the Flames, Yegor Sharangovich had a noteworthy performance, contributing the opening goal and setting an energetic tone for his team. Blake Coleman not only scored the critical third goal but his overall play helped stabilize the Flames' offense.
On the other side, Evan Bouchard stood out for the Oilers, tallying a goal and an assist. His contributions kept the Oilers competitive and highlighted his ability to perform under pressure. Connor McDavid’s late goal showcased his determination, but despite his efforts, the team couldn’t find the equalizer.
